What to Do When Your Vehicle Is Towed in Herston

Realising your vehicle has been towed can strike a wave of panic, especially in a bustling suburb like Herston. You're left with a sinking feeling as you think about the time wasted and the potential costs involved. Imagine just finishing a long day at the Royal Brisbane and Women's Hospital, only to find your car missing from the parking lot. The stress of having to navigate the recovery process can feel overwhelming, especially when you might be running late for an important meeting or need to pick up groceries from the nearby Centro Buranda shopping centre.

It's essential to stay calm and take immediate steps to locate your vehicle. First, check for any removal notices that might provide information about where your vehicle has been taken. If you suspect it was towed due to illegal parking—such as being in a clearway on Herston Road—calling Brisbane City Council at 07 3403 8888 is your best bet. They can confirm if your car has been impounded, and guide you on the necessary steps to reclaim it. For more detailed information about the towing process and regulations, consult the Brisbane City Council towing page.

Find Impound Locations and Recovery Details in Herston

If your vehicle has indeed been towed from Herston, knowing where to go for recovery is crucial. The nearest impound yard is located at 2-4 Black Street in Fortitude Valley, which is approximately 3.5 kilometres from Herston. This facility operates from Monday to Friday, 8:00 AM to 4:00 PM, making it essential to plan your visit accordingly. Additionally, remember to bring proof of ownership, such as your vehicle registration or insurance documents, which are necessary for you to reclaim your car from the tow yard.

Should you have any questions about the towing policies or wish to report any issues, the Queensland Police Service offers a Queensland towing scheme details that can provide further assistance. It's wise to stay informed on the laws that govern vehicle towing in Herston to avoid any future inconveniences. Understanding these regulations not only helps you navigate recovery but can also aid in preventing potential towing incidents in the future. Understanding Towed Vehicle Fees and Costs in Herston

If your vehicle has been towed in Herston, understanding the associated fees is crucial. The impound recovery costs typically start with a release fee, which can be around $300 AUD. On top of this, expect to pay daily storage fees of approximately $50 AUD per day as your car sits in the lot. Residents near the North Coast Line station often utilize public transport to avoid such fees, but parking in clearways or across driveways can lead to these hefty charges. Payment methods are flexible and can include cash, EFTPOS, or credit cards.

To reclaim your vehicle, you must call the Brisbane City Council at 07 3403 8888 and arrange for collection from the tow company. It's essential to have your vehicle's reference number ready, which will help streamline the process, especially for those living near landmarks like the Cross River Rail station or Car Wash Road. Time matters when recovering your car. Each passing day adds another $50 to your bill, so act quickly once you've located your vehicle in the impound system.

Know Your Rights: Disputing Tows in Herston

Residents of Herston should know their rights when it comes to wrongful towing. If you believe your vehicle was removed improperly, you can dispute the tow by contacting the Brisbane City Council with all relevant documentation. Make sure you have proof of ownership and any applicable permits, as this will aid in your claim. The process for disputing a tow requires written evidence and patience, but it's worth pursuing if you're confident the removal was unjustified.

If you find yourself in this situation, it's also advisable to familiarize yourself with the Queensland Towing Scheme. This program outlines the rights of vehicle owners and the procedures to file a compensation claim. Being informed can save you both time and money when dealing with towing disputes. Document everything: photos of parking signs, timestamps, witness statements. These details become crucial if you need to escalate your dispute or seek legal advice regarding the unlawful removal of your vehicle.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the impound locations in Herston, Queensland?

In Herston, vehicles that have been towed can typically be retrieved from the Brisbane City Council's designated impound yard. This location serves as the central hub for vehicles removed from the surrounding areas, including nearby streets like Butterfield Street and Wridgways Street. Make sure to have your identification and proof of ownership ready when you visit.

How much are recovery fees for towed vehicles in Herston?

Recovery fees for towed vehicles in Herston vary depending on the type of vehicle and the circumstances of the tow. Generally, the fees start at around $250 for standard cars, and additional daily storage fees may apply, which can accumulate quickly if the vehicle is not claimed promptly. It's advisable to contact the towing company directly to get the exact amount before heading out.

What towing rules apply in Herston, Queensland?

Towing rules in Herston are enforced to ensure road safety and compliance with local regulations. Vehicles may be towed if they are parked in clearways, no stopping zones, or obstructing driveways. Areas around major landmarks, such as the Herston Quarter and the Royal Brisbane and Women's Hospital, are particularly monitored for illegal parking.

What are my legal rights if my vehicle is towed in Herston?

If your vehicle is towed in Herston, you have the right to contest the tow if you believe it was unjustified. You can contact the Brisbane City Council at 07 3403 8888 for guidance on the appeals process. It’s crucial to gather any evidence, such as photographs and witness statements, especially if you parked lawfully near local spots like the Herston Health Precinct.

How long do I have to claim my towed vehicle in Herston?

In Herston, you have 28 days to claim your towed vehicle from the date it was impounded. After this period, unclaimed vehicles may be sold or auctioned off by the Brisbane City Council. To avoid losing your vehicle, it’s best to act quickly and retrieve it from the impound yard, especially if it was towed from busy areas near the Queensland Brain Institute.
